| Mash Tool Usage |
| These pages document the user interface and command-line invocation to the Mash tools. This documentation supercedes conventional Unix manual page entries. If you want information on scripting new Mash tools or extending the mash interpreter, see the scripting pages.
* WARNING: Only tools marked "*" have been tested recently. None of the tools have been fully tested. The current version of Mash is still an experimental release.
